description Melioidosis is an infection caused by a gram-negative bacterium, which is widely distributed in fresh surface water and soil in endemic regions. Melioidosis occurs predominantly in Southeast Asia, South Asia, northern Australia and China. Fatal melioidosis commonly occurs in individuals with specific comorbidities including diabetes mellitus, harmful use of alcohol, chronic lung disease and chronic kidney disease. The most common acute manifestation is pneumonia. Other sites of infection include skin, soft tissue and genitourinary tract. We present a case of melioidosis in a 52-year-old farmer presenting with acalculous cholecystitis and acute pyelonephritis which was successfully treated with antibiotics.
